Should we water asparagus fern thoroughly? How to water it thoroughly?

1. Do you need to water thoroughly?

When watering asparagus fern, be sure to water the soil thoroughly. Only by watering slowly and thoroughly can the water penetrate into the deep soil and the roots at the bottom can absorb water and grow stronger. But at the same time, it is very afraid of waterlogging. If the amount of watering is not controlled during maintenance, waterlogging and root rot will easily occur.

2. How to calculate thorough watering

1. There is water at the bottom of the pot: When watering it, you can observe the bottom of the pot, because there are drainage holes at the bottom of the pot. After watering thoroughly, water will flow out from the bottom of the pot or it will be relatively moist. But watering must be done slowly, not with large amounts of water.

2. Listen to the sound: After watering, gently tap the flower pot. If the sound is dull and the soil is moist, it means it is watered thoroughly. On the contrary, if the sound is very crisp, it is most likely that it was not watered thoroughly.

3. Feel the weight: People who often grow plants will use this method. Feel the weight of the entire flowerpot by yourself, before and after watering, and then compare them to know whether it is watered thoroughly.

4. There is water at the mouth of the pot: Usually, after watering it thoroughly, there is usually water at the mouth of the pot, and it will not seep down for a while. In this case, it is mostly watered. Generally, if the plant is not watered thoroughly, the water will slowly penetrate into the deep soil and there will be no water at the mouth of the pot.
